Voting is open for the sixth annual contest celebrating the manufacturing sector, Makers Madness: The Coolest Thing Made in Illinois. Three Geneva businesses are competing and would love to have your votes.
Makers Madness is an Illinois Manufacturing online contest highlighting local manufacturers and the fantastic products that are made right here in Illinois.
Geneva products featured in the 2025 contest include:
Joseph Renard String Instruments
Handmade violins, violas and cellos are crafted in Geneva. These instruments are the first made in Illinois in more than 100 years.

There are several rounds of online voting, which will narrow down the field to the top four products made in Illinois. People are allowed to vote five times per day per device. The overall champion - and the title of the Coolest Thing Made in Illinois - will be named on Wednesday, April 9 at a special ceremony in Springfield.
